Camping and hiking fees at NT parks and walking trails to increase from July 1

An essential part of the Territory lifestyle — hiking and camping — is about to become significantly more expensive.

Over the next three years, starting this July, weekend campers and multi-day trekkers will pay increasingly higher park fees, the NT government announced today.

Here are the main things you need to know before digging deeper into your pockets to enjoy the natural beauty of the Northern Territory.

Camping fees are increasing

For the first time since 2000, campers will pay more to sleep at NT campsites.
